We had so much fun designing this backyard Mini Golf Course and even more fun playing on it! Since we are stuck in quarantine and everything is closed, this was an awesome way to spend a Saturday afternoon!
The course took us about 3 hours to play through and swapping out the obstacles/hole layouts was actually pretty easy. We planned on keeping score and making a real competition out of it, but we were having so much fun we lost track of the score about halfway through.

After all the homemade mini-golf courses that I've seen on KZbin, this by far is the best one. How much money and time did it take to build a full 18 holes and what supplies did you use?
@NothingToDoCrew
@NothingToDoCrew 4 жыл бұрын
Thanks!! I had bought all the wood at an auction for like 40$ so the only thing i really had to buy was the carpet (which i picked up at lowes for 40-50$). Most of the obstacles were made from stuff repurposed from other videos (and other junk from my garage), so it didnt take a ton of time to build/setup. On the day we filmed this, we started at 11 and ended at 3pm (we took a break halfway through to eat lunch). If i were to start from scratch it would probably be pretty expensive and take a little more time... If you are planning on building something similar, take a look around at what you got and build obstacles around them. For example, the tree stump hole i just tossed some logs on the hole and added some axes to make the shots a little more difficult.

How did you make the loop
@NothingToDoCrew
@NothingToDoCrew Жыл бұрын
I cut a 12" wide strip from a plastic barrel/drum, then screwed it down to the wood. then i glued on some pipe insulators for the edges. If you don't have a drum/barrel you could use the plastic from two home depot buckets.

I’ve been thinking on making one of these, how much did this typically cost
@NothingToDoCrew
@NothingToDoCrew 4 жыл бұрын
Cost varies depending on if you are going with a raised platform, or if you are just going to put the plywood on the ground. For a basic hole, i would say 80$ (i dont know for sure since i used materials from other projects). I would say 20$x3 for the plywood, 10$ for the grass, 2.50x7 for the 2x4 borders
